Afrofuturism refers to cultural production primarily by Afro-diasporic artists who draw on science fiction and other futurist ideas, sounds and iconography. The (ever growing) body of work which has been discussed under the umbrella term of Afrofuturism ranges from literature to visual arts and music (the latter of which will be a focus of this course).
Students will be invited to analyse different texts, images, and musical pieces and investigate how afrofuturistic ideas are constructed through and around these works. This will be discussed in relation to representations of Blackness and its stereotyped and often racist implications in the context of postcolonial power structures.
